Top Aerospace Engineering Schools in Maryland

University of Maryland – College Park

The University of Maryland – College Park (UMD) is renowned for its top-tier aerospace engineering program, consistently ranked among the best by national metrics. The program offers a Bachelor’s, Master’s, and Ph.D. in Aerospace Engineering, providing a comprehensive educational pathway. The curriculum covers a wide range of topics, including aerodynamics, propulsion, and spacecraft design.

Faculty and Research

UMD boasts an impressive faculty known for their groundbreaking research and industry experience. Students benefit from access to state-of-the-art research facilities like the Glenn L. Martin Wind Tunnel and the Neutral Buoyancy Research Facility. These resources allow students to engage in innovative research projects, preparing them for advanced careers in aerospace engineering.

Industry Connections

UMD maintains strong ties with major aerospace organizations, including NASA and major defense contractors. These partnerships offer students valuable internship and job placement opportunities, ensuring a seamless transition from academia to the professional world.

Special Programs

The school also offers unique initiatives like the Women in Aeronautics and Astronautics program, which aims to promote diversity and inclusion in the field. This program provides mentorship, networking opportunities, and specialized workshops to support women pursuing careers in aerospace engineering.

Johns Hopkins University

Johns Hopkins University (JHU) may not offer a direct aerospace engineering degree, but its Mechanical Engineering program is highly relevant and equally prestigious. Ranked among the top engineering schools in the U.S., JHU provides an interdisciplinary approach that prepares students for various aerospace careers.

Curriculum and Research

JHU emphasizes research and hands-on learning, offering numerous opportunities to participate in cutting-edge projects. The faculty is known for their contributions to fluid dynamics, aerodynamics, and systems engineering. This interdisciplinary approach ensures that students acquire a broad skill set applicable across multiple sectors of aerospace engineering.

Facilities and Resources

The university’s laboratories and research centers are equipped with advanced technology, enabling students to conduct high-level research. Collaborations with nearby institutions and organizations further enhance learning and professional development.

Alumni Network

JHU’s strong alumni network provides mentoring, networking, and career opportunities for graduates. Many alumni hold influential positions in aerospace companies and research institutions, showcasing the program’s effectiveness in producing industry leaders.

United States Naval Academy

The United States Naval Academy (USNA) offers a rigorous aerospace engineering program designed to produce highly skilled engineers and leaders. The program is accredited and focuses on delivering a well-rounded education that includes both theoretical and practical components.

Curriculum and Practical Experience

The USNA program emphasizes leadership and hands-on experience. The curriculum includes courses in aerodynamics, propulsion, and structural mechanics, coupled with real-world applications. Midshipmen participate in practical projects that simulate real-life engineering challenges.

Faculty and Facilities

USNA boasts experienced faculty with backgrounds in military and civilian aerospace projects. Facilities like the Aerospace Laboratory and the Hydromechanics Laboratory are equipped with modern technology to support extensive research and hands-on learning.

Career Pathways

Graduates of the USNA aerospace engineering program typically pursue careers in the military or in civilian aerospace sectors. The academy’s strong emphasis on leadership and ethics ensures that graduates are well-prepared for the professional demands of the field.

Success Stories from Graduates

Notable Alumni Achievements

Graduates from Maryland’s top aerospace engineering schools have made remarkable contributions to the field. For example, Robert Rashford, a UMD alumni, founded Genesis Engineering to develop spacecraft systems. He has also contributed to numerous NASA projects.

Career Path Successes

UMD alumni frequently secure positions at prominent aerospace companies like Boeing, Kaman Air Vehicles, and the U.S. Army Research Lab. This indicates the high quality of education and the strong industry connections the program offers.
